GS4B032320GCT Description
The GS4B032320GCT from TT Electronics/IRC is a high-performance thin-film resistor network designed for precision applications. This 7-resistor array features a 232Ω resistance value per resistor with a tight 2% tolerance and a low ±25ppm/°C temperature coefficient, ensuring stable performance across a wide temperature range of 70°C to 125°C. Housed in a ceramic SOIC-8 package, it offers 0.4W total power dissipation (0.05W per resistor) and a maximum voltage rating of 100V. Its gull-wing termination and surface-mount design make it ideal for automated assembly processes. The non-automotive, non-PPAP compliant device is supplied in a tube packaging, suitable for industrial and commercial applications.
GS4B032320GCT Features
- Precision Thin-Film Technology: Delivers high accuracy (±2%) and low TCR (±25ppm/°C) for stable operation.
- Robust Ceramic Construction: Ensures durability and thermal stability in harsh environments.
- Compact SOIC-8 Package: Space-saving 4.9mm × 5.99mm × 1.45mm footprint with 1.27mm terminal pitch.
- High Power Handling: 0.4W total power rating (0.05W per resistor) supports demanding circuits.
- Wide Temperature Range: Operates reliably from 70°C to 125°C with derated power.
- Non-Compliant with EU RoHS: Suitable for legacy or niche applications where RoHS is not required.
